Transaction 938fcc6cfe99506163638ee80fb2edfe980289cced88e34c1619b1db1af0b610

1 Input
2 Outputs
  • 938fcc6cfe99506163638ee80fb2edfe980289cced88e34c1619b1db1af0b610:0
  • value  324241
    address  3ANBUiTJ6cU5GJEqpnmF117iDPYBHMC6U7
  • 938fcc6cfe99506163638ee80fb2edfe980289cced88e34c1619b1db1af0b610:1
  • value  10794056
    address  14EffaaZTenmCS2WRAuffbGGw42Nd9s8M8